S E Railway trains cancelled for fog

Jamshedpur,  Nov 29: South Eastern Railway ( SER ) has decided to cancel several trains in view of the upcoming foggy season.

The office of the chief passenger transportation manager ( CPTM) today issued a list of cancelled trains.

The Santragachi-Anand Vihar Express ( 22857 / 22858) which travels via Tatanagar railway station will remain cancelled from December 6 to February 28. The  Hatia-Anand Vihar Express ( 12873 / 12874 ) will remain cancelled from November 30 to February 28. The 18103/18104 Tatanagar-Amritsar Express will remain cancelled from November 29 to February 28.

Moreover, the frequency of several trains will be reduced. The 12365/12366 Patna-Ranchi-Patna Express will remain cancelled on every Friday in December , January  and February.
